Do your goods for export have to cover long transport distances, especially by sea and air freight? If this is the case, they are often exposed to extreme climatic conditions and strong variations in temperature and humidity, which could damage the final packaged product.

desiccant moisture absorber


Swollen packaging, musty odors and mold growth are just some of the damage that can occur on long trips without moisture protection. In addition, the condensation that forms attacks packaging and spoils food products, corrode metals and reduces the quality of leather and textiles.

It should be noted that condensation forms everywhere and that it seeps even into the hermetically sealed transport containers during the long weeks of freight. Water vapor is the most dangerous enemy for moisture-sensitive goods.

Desiccant bags absorb condensation, which forms in packaging while transporting and storing goods, thus solving the humidity problem.

Fluctuations in temperature can lead to the condensation of water vapor inside the packaging, which can cause serious damage to the goods they contain. Therefore, the desiccant bags are inserted in the packaging to prevent humidity and condensation and to protect the transported goods.

Thanks to their preventive effect, desiccants based on alumina are widely used in industry, the automotive and electronics sectors, and the military sector.

These agents are also used to protect cultural property. Our desiccant bags based on alumina bentonite and non-woven fabric are characterized by a strong desiccant power, which allows them to absorb water vapor up to 18.5 +/- 1.5% of their weight.

They thus prevent the formation of condensation and protect against corrosion.

This water-soluble, non-toxic moisture shield is made from a natural material, particularly suitable for food and pharmaceutical applications.

Container desiccants, on the other hand, are used to counteract the problem of condensation and the formation of moisture in containers during transport, thus protecting the load from corrosion and mold.

The temperature differences between day and night generate a large amount of water vapor ("rain effect"), which can penetrate the container and cause considerable damage to the goods transported and their packaging.

Hygroscopic materials used for packaging (wood and cardboard) can also release condensation water. However, container desiccants reduce the air's relative humidity, reducing the risk of condensation and moisture damage.

Made from calcium chloride and clay, our container desiccant lowers the dew point. It is ideal for transporting and storing machinery, electronic components, consumer goods, metals, etc. It is an inexpensive and reliable dehumidifier.

Humidity indicators in the form of paper strips are an effective and inexpensive way to monitor the relative humidity inside a package during transport and storage. The handling is very simple: the moisture indicator is inserted into the packaging, and the color of the dots indicates the moisture content of the packaging.

The colors of the dots have the following meaning: brown = dry, and light blue = wet. Our practical and cost-effective cobalt-free moisture indicator consists of a strip of paper impregnated with an active ingredient. It is based on a reversible system: the points change from blue to pink when the relative humidity exceeds the authorized value to return to blue when the humidity drops to the expected value.

Aluminum composite barrier films serve as hermetic packaging to protect goods from the weather, even under extreme temperatures, during long-term storage and transportation by sea, land and air.

In combination with desiccants, the aluminum composite film is completely suitable to protect your goods exposed to the risk of corrosion. It also guarantees water tightness and resistance to humidity, light, thermal influences and UV rays. Our aluminum composite film comprises three layers: an outer polyester layer and an inner high-density polyethylene layer, separated by an aluminum foil.

It is available in the form of rolls, tubes, sachets and custom-made covers to best meet each of your needs. Our composite film, easily heat-sealed, has high mechanical strength and resistance to tearing and tear propagation.

Thus, it offers effective protection against corrosion, humidity and salty air and complies with MIL-PRF-131K, class I regulations. In addition, it guarantees long-term preservation of up to 10 years.
